The Lagoon 470 is a magnificent catamaran constructed by the Jeanneau shipyards, sleeping up to 8 passengers. The original design of the roof and the portholes, the easy access from the skirts to the cockpit and the saloon illustrate maximum use of space. Its surface and volume are beyond belief for a catamaran this size. On top of that, no mooring will be out of reach for this cat thanks to its shallow draught.
You will be able to enjoy the pleasures of navigating and the various activities proposed while dicovering one of the most beautiful paradises on earth in incomparable comfort. This boat and its skipper (hostess and all inclusive formula on request) will help you live an unforgettable cruise.

In a bareboat charter, the charterer is responsible for the provisioning of the yacht. If you have your boat license and solid sailing experience, you will be able to steer your boat yourself. If your nautical CV is not sufficient, we can offer you bareboat charters with the services of a skipper and/or hostess/cook. Nevertheless, you will legally remain the charterer and therefore the person in charge of the boat and its navigation.
Crewed boat charters concern boats between 16 and 20 m with a crew (skipper, hostess, sailor) dedicated to a specific yacht. The crew takes care of you and the boat. The vessels we offer are in excellent condition and have professional crews offering a top-of-the-range service.

Your yacht must meet your needs in terms of size and capacity. A modern motor yacht will, for example, be suitable for a family charter by offering beautiful spaces. A sailing yacht will be a fantastic choice for a boating enthusiast.
For bareboat charters, the yacht itself with its insurance. Your broker will be able to tell you the price of a crew and other services such as provisioning. You will have to pay the deposit and the requested options upon delivery of the boat.
For crewed and luxury types of charters, the charter of the yacht itself with its insurance, water toys (jet ski, seabob, kayak etc.) and the crew's salary are included. Some contracts include food and up to 4 hours of engine operation. For others, in addition to the rental price, you may have to pay VAT (the rate varies depending on the sailing area), and an advance provisioning allowance (APA) to cover the cost of food and drinks, fuel, port and mooring fees, communication or delivery costs.
